Find Parcel Shops - All couriers on one map
All Parcel Shops
Parcel Shops In United Kingdom
Parcel Shops In Halifax
Park Lane
Park Lane in Halifax
2 Park Lane
Halifax
West Yorkshire
HX3 9ED
Couriers